What you'll be doing;
- Conduct scheduled physical inspections by company Quality, Health, Safety and Environmental (QHSE) procedures
- Carry out operational Planned Preventive Maintenance (PPM) checks and report findings with the shift supervisor and maintenance supervisor
- Communicate clear instructions and information to MBT operatives to support operations and high emphasis will be placed on the plant availability and the performance of the biological process
- Record all defects and findings accordingly and assist with KPI data entry
- The Senior Technician is required to have an excellent understanding of the SCADA system and will be expected to independently fault-find and rectify issues via this and the plant's equipment
- Provide line management with specialist knowledge and hands-on expertise in rectifying and preventing problems such as equipment failure, material blockages and biological process inefficiencies
- Prepare both facilities for daily operation and carry out necessary pre-start equipment checks in conjunction with the shift supervisor
